Get started11 Grange Street is a mid-terrace house in Burnley (BB11 4JZ). It has a recorded floor area of 59 m² (around 635 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(January 2026) returns an A (score 105), the top energy band on the EPC scale. When first surveyed in May 2011 the rating was G, the property has climbed 6 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Very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Good; while window ef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. Main heating runs on electricity. This certificate was lodged in the last six months, so the rating reflects current condition.
Sale prices here have outpaced Burnley HPI: 2.4% per year against 0.4%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£117,000 sits 61.4% above the 2025 sale of £72,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£114/sq ft) was about 175.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. A recent sale: £72,500 in August 2025. Across the public record there are 6 sales, relatively high churn for a single property.
